Folios 252-253: Alexander Fraser, HMS Redoubt, Woolwich. Reports he has put the floating battery into commission on 12 July, and is using seamen from HMS Savage to fit her out until he receives further orders. As no warrant officers have yet been appointed, recommends William Jump, one of the Riggers in Woolwich Yard, who has served as Boatswain of several ships and who is recommended by the Master Attendant.
